Output 0523042d13f09ed75db3690ac3f833fc69a0c5050265b286852ee93a165ff759:207

value
25307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e08f3b7587d5a1661d18091bda6caca607a8d0 OP_EQUAL
address
364AhE9PTMp2goWguUsBnF2Fxf3Y4CpSsF
transaction
0523042d13f09ed75db3690ac3f833fc69a0c5050265b286852ee93a165ff759
spent
true